Electoral Commissioner resigns in Rivers 

 

CITIZENS COMPASS–Following the recent Supreme Court ruling that annulled the October 5, 2024, Local Government Council elections in Rivers State, the commissioner for Transport, Logistics, and Stores at the State Independent Electoral Commission (RSIEC), Ibierembo Evelyn Thompson, has resigned.

Her resignation letter was dated March 9, 2025.

The letter cited the judgment as the primary reason for her departure.

The Commissioner expressed gratitude for the opportunity to serve and wished the Commission well in its future endeavors.

Her resignation comes amid escalating political tensions in the state.

The Rivers State House of Assembly has issued a warrant for the arrest of the Chairman of the Rivers State Independent Electoral Commission (RSIEC), Justice Adolphus Enebeli (rtd), following his failure to honor multiple summons by the lawmakers.

During a plenary session on Monday, the Assembly resolved to take legal action after the RSIEC chairman ignored a 72-hour ultimatum to appear before the House. Lawmakers had initially given him 48 hours to respond but extended the deadline to allow him to provide explanations regarding the controversial October 2024 local government elections, which were later nullified.
